After easily their worst performance of the season against Manly, the Warriors came up with probably their best display of 2021 on Sunday, to beat the Dragons 20-14. Captain Roger Tuivasa-Sheck was exceptional in his 100th game and his solo try late in the second half proved the difference. Some individual magic from Tuivasa-Sheck – who beat three defenders off a flat Nikorima pass – took the Warriors back into the ascendancy with 15 minutes to play, before a Nikorima penalty extended their lead, which they never rescinded, despite some late Dragons pressure. Warriors 20 (Tohu Harris, Paul Turner, Roger Tuivasa-Sheck tries; Kodi Nikorima 3 cons, pen)Dragons 14 (Cody Ramsay, Mikaele Ravalawa, Matt Dufty tries; Zac Lomax con)HT: 12-8
